In brief: Brazil

* China’s ministry of commerce has confirmed the imposition of anti-dumping tariffs on imports of Brazilian chicken products. From 17 February, tariffs from 17.8% to 32.4% will be imposed on imports of Brazilian chicken products and will remain in place for five years. Following months of negotiations with producers, China has agreed to exempt 14 Brazilian companies from the anti-dumping duties, including JBS and BRF, provided they do not sell their products at a lower price than previously agreed. Brazil, the world’s second largest producer of chicken, is the principal exporter of frozen chicken products to China.
